Demographics details for York, SC vs Brundidge, AL
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in York, SC vs Brundidge, AL.
Data | York | Brundidge |
---|---|---|
Population | 8,648 | 2,034 |
Median Age | 37.0 years | 49.9 years |
Median Income | $50,177 | $37,627 |
Married Families | 27.0% | 39.0% |
Poverty Level | 11% | 20% |
Unemployment Rate | 4.2 | 4.0 |
Population Comparison: York vs Brundidge
- In York, the population is higher at 8,648, compared to 2,034 in Brundidge.
- The median age in Brundidge is higher at 49.9 years, compared to 37.0 years in York.
- York has a higher median income of $50,177 compared to $37,627 in Brundidge.
- In Brundidge, the percentage of married families is higher at 39.0%, compared to 27.0% in York.
- The poverty level is higher in Brundidge at 20%, compared to 11% in York.
- The unemployment rate in York is higher at 4.2%, compared to 4.0% in Brundidge.

Health Statistics
The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.
Health Metric | York | Brundidge |
---|---|---|
Mental Health Not Good | 18.5% | 20.5% |
Physical Health Not Good | 13.0% | 15.2% |
Depression | 21.4% | 20.7% |
Smoking | 18.9% | 23.1% |
Binge Drinking | 15.7% | 12.2% |
Obesity | 39.0% | 45.7% |
Disability Percentage | 13.0% | 25.0% |
Health Statistics Comparison: York vs Brundidge
- In Brundidge,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 20.5% compared to 18.5% in York.
- Depression is more prevalent in York at 21.4% compared to 20.7% in Brundidge.
- Brundidge has a higher smoking rate at 23.1% compared to 18.9% in York.
- Binge drinking is more common in York at 15.7% compared to 12.2% in Brundidge.
- Brundidge has higher obesity rates at 45.7% compared to 39.0% in York.
- There is a higher percentage of disabled individuals in Brundidge at 25.0% compared to 13.0% in York.
